MKT students receive merit award in media campaign

Two students from the Department of Marketing, Natiss Suen Chik-nam and Kristin Choi Nga-sze, earned a merit prize in Media Campaign 2018 organised by SOW Asia, SOW (Asia), a charitable foundation that supports enterprises to scale social and environmental impact through financial investment and accelerator programme.  

Participating students were asked to produce a 1-minute video to promote a social enterprise. With a theme of 香港夢。聚音樂 (embrace the Hong Kong music dream), the team produced a video to promote digital music education platform TapTab.io. The plot is about how a passionate young man in a hustle and bustle city like Hong Kong, pursued his music dream by self-learning on the platform.

Natiss shared that video shooting and editing were new to the team, they also paid a lot of effort in brainstorming the theme and delivering the message. “The media campaign was a nice learning opportunity for us. Being a future marketer, creativity is always important in the dynamic era. I believe the award is great motivation for driving us to succeed!” She said.

Kristin said, “I feel grateful and excited for getting the merit award. Most importantly, we have applied the concept and knowledge learnt in class into practice, it was truly a valuable chance for me to gain real life marketing experience.”
